Potstickers

- 1 lb. ground pork shopping list
- 1-1/2 cups chopped cabbage (about 3 oz.) shopping list
- 4 green onions, chopped (about 1/3 cup) shopping list
- 1 egg, lightly beaten shopping list
- 1/4 cup Asian Sesame with ginger Dressing, divided shopping list
- 1/4 cup soy sauce, divided shopping list
- 1 pkg. (12 oz.) round won ton wrappers (about 4 doz.) shopping list
- 10 tsp. oil, divided 1-1/4 cups water, divided shopping list
- *If round won ton wrappers are unavailable, use square won ton wrappers. Fill as directed, folding in half to form a triangle and omitting the pleating step. shopping list
How to make it
- MIX pork, cabbage, onions, egg and 2 Tbsp. each of the dressing and soy sauce until well blended. Spoon evenly onto won ton wrappers, adding about 1 tsp. of the pork mixture to each wrapper. Moisten edge of each wrapper with water; fold in half to form a half-moon, pressing edges together to seal. If desired, edges can be pleated with five or six folds.
- HEAT 2 tsp. of the oil in large nonstick skillet on medium-high heat. Add 10 dumplings; cook 1 to 1-1/2 min. or until bottoms are golden brown. Gradually add 1/4 cup of the water; cover.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ook 2 to 2-1/2 min. or until filling is cooked through and water has evaporated. Remove dumplings to serving plate; wipe skillet dry. Repeat with remaining dumplings.
- COMBINE remaining 2 Tbsp. dressing, remaining 2 Tbsp. soy sauce and remaining 1 Tbsp. water. Serve as a dipping sauce with the dumplings.
